notes

Aster uses a simple pop-oriented approach to songwriting layered with lush piano, overdriven synthesizers, and ambient sounds that reach to the heavens above. Raspy and pristine vocal melodies combine with driving rhythms, deep guitar tones, and a wall of sound from the keys to produce a truly captivating sonic experience. The end result of this diverse montage of sound is a new breed of pop distortion, but with substance. It's all about writing innovative music that still creates feelings people can relate to. Using traditional logic, they searched for additional members to complete a "live lineup" for almost six months. Somewhere along the way they realized it was possible to remain a two-piece and still crank out as much, if not more, sound than any other live band. Using a standard issue pair of headphones and a synthesis of bass and guitar amplifiers, their sound becomes truly distinct and simultaneously addicting.
